Reclaiming Indigenous Knowledge

Indigenous peoples around the globe have been practicing their knowledge for generations. This heritage is deeply rooted with their cultures, languages, and beliefs. However, colonialism and systemic violence have threatened this essential knowledge. Now, there is a growing movement to reclaim Indigenous knowledge and share it with the world. This journey involves honoring Indigenous voices, preserving traditional practices, and creating partnerships between Indigenous communities and institutions. By uplifting Indigenous knowledge, we can create a more equitable future for all.
